How To Fix KI532 - No authorization to change planning in CO area & .


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: KI -

  • Message number: 532

  • Message text: No authorization to change planning in CO area & .

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    You do not have the authorization to change business process planning
    in controlling area &V1&.

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message KI532 - No authorization to change planning in CO area & . ?

    The SAP error message KI532, which states "No authorization to change planning in CO area," typically occurs when a user attempts to make changes to planning data in a controlling (CO) area without having the necessary authorizations. This error is related to the authorization checks in SAP, specifically for controlling area planning activities.

    Cause:

    The primary cause of this error is a lack of appropriate authorization in the user's role or profile. In SAP, authorization objects control access to various functions, and for planning activities in the CO area, specific authorizations are required. The error indicates that the user does not have the necessary permissions to modify planning data in the specified controlling area.

    Solution:

    To resolve the KI532 error, follow these steps:

    1. Check User Authorizations:

      • Verify the user's roles and authorizations in the SAP system. This can be done by using transaction code SU53 immediately after the error occurs. This transaction shows the last authorization check and can help identify which specific authorization is missing.
    2. Review Authorization Objects:

      • The relevant authorization objects for CO planning include:
        • K_CCA (Cost Center Accounting)
        • K_COH (Controlling Area)
        • K_CPR (Profit Center Accounting)
      • Ensure that the user has the necessary authorizations for these objects, particularly for the specific controlling area they are trying to access.
    3. Modify User Roles:

      • If the user lacks the necessary authorizations, a security administrator or someone with the appropriate permissions should modify the user's roles to include the required authorizations for planning in the CO area.
    4. Testing:

      • After updating the authorizations, have the user log out and log back in to ensure that the changes take effect. Then, attempt the planning activity again to see if the error persists.
    5. Consult Documentation:

      • If you are unsure about the required authorizations, consult the SAP documentation or your organization's SAP security team for guidance on the necessary roles and authorizations for CO planning.

    Related Information:

    • Transaction Codes:

      • SU01: User Maintenance (to check or modify user roles)
      • PFCG: Role Maintenance (to manage roles and authorizations)
      • SU53: Authorization Check Analysis (to analyze authorization issues)
    • SAP Notes:

      • Check SAP Notes for any specific guidance or updates related to the KI532 error, as SAP frequently updates its documentation and may provide additional insights or solutions.
    • Training and Support:

      • If the issue persists or if there are complexities in managing authorizations, consider reaching out to your SAP support team or consulting with an SAP security expert.

    By following these steps, you should be able to identify and resolve the authorization issue causing the KI532 error in SAP.
